Cash and Carrie, by Helen Stuwart, was the three act comedy which the Senior Class presented, November 21, under the co-directors Mrs. Clarkson and Mr. Cobb. This hilarious play kept the huge audience In laughter from the time the curtain went up until the very end. The characters were as follows: Carrie - - - - ■ Uncle Omar - - ■ Trig............ Kempy , portrayed by Lyle English was the center of Interest In the complicated lives of the Bence family. The supporting cast consisted of: Beulah Anderson, Freida Kramer, Bob Pearson, Jerry Aitken, Barbara Baron, Ruth Rosemurgy, and Kenneth Wedge. The play was directed by Ulss lone Lautner. Although delayed by bad weather conditions, the play proved to be a great success in all ways.
